LAHORE: A seminar was organised on Wednesday by the Department of Social Sciences at the University of Management and Technology to focus on the development of children with special needs. The seminar was attended by various non governmental organisations including Ameen Maktib, Rising Sun Education and Welfare Society and Ghazali Education Trust. Ameen Maktib representative Khawar Sultana said her institution was involved in equipping children with special needs with modern learning and added that more teachers should be trained to cater to the needs of these children. Dr Abdul Tawwab, of Rising Sun Education and Welfare Society, said that society should address the issues of children with special needs.
